Course Overview

The Doctor of Philosophy in Communication at the University of Southern California is a prestigious research-focused program designed to develop advanced scholars and professionals in the field of communication. Offered through the Annenberg School for Communication and Journalism, the program emphasizes interdisciplinary research, critical theory, and innovative methodologies to address complex communication challenges in areas such as media, culture, technology, and policy.

Unique features include access to cutting-edge research centers, opportunities for collaboration with industry leaders, and a strong emphasis on preparing graduates for academic and leadership roles. The program fosters a global perspective, encouraging students to engage with pressing societal issues through communication research.
